Samsung Galaxy On7 Prime has an overall score of 76.9, which is a bit better than Motorola Moto G10's 75.1 global score. Despite of the fact that Samsung Galaxy On7 Prime is noticeably older than Motorola Moto G10, it's body is somewhat thinner and lighter. Galaxy On7 Prime features a little more vivid screen than Motorola Moto G10, because although it has a little bit smaller screen, it also counts with a higher 1080 x 1920 resolution and a greater amount of pixels per screen inch.
Moto G10 counts with a bit superior processing unit than Galaxy On7 Prime. Both have the same RAM memory amount and a Octa-Core CPU. The Motorola Moto G10 has a slightly better storage to store more apps and games than Samsung Galaxy On7 Prime, and although they both have equal internal storage, the Motorola Moto G10 also has a slot for SD memory cards that supports a maximum of 512 GB.
The Motorola Moto G10 counts with a much longer battery life than Samsung Galaxy On7 Prime, because it has 5000mAh of battery capacity. Motorola Moto G10 has a superior camera than Galaxy On7 Prime, and although they both have the same (Full HD) video definition, the Motorola Moto G10 also has faster 60 fps video frame rate, a back camera with a much higher resolution and a larger diafragm aperture for better low-light captures and videos.
